Rods
Cells in the retina known as photoreceptors are crucial for enabling vision in dimly lit environments.
Night Vision
The ability to see in low light conditions, often enhanced by technological means in humans but naturally occurring in certain animal species.
Color
A characteristic of visual perception described through categories such as hue, saturation, and brightness, which results from the way an object reflects or emits light.
Fovea
A small, central pit in the retina of the eye responsible for sharp central vision, essential for activities where visual detail is of primary importance, like reading and driving.
